    Team Kennedys Finance team support the Firm globally producing timely and accurate financial and management information, reporting solutions and operational support to maintain the high standard of service offered to the Firm's internal and external clients.

    Key Responsibilities Provide a comprehensive collection control service - pursue debtors frequently and effectively by telephone, email and letter to secure payment within US Kennedys agreed payment terms and Client Guidelines.

    Proactively engage fee earners and partners to improve collections and reduce debtor days. Review aged debt lists regularly to identify bills that can be chased and ensuring that the debtors are contacted. Ensure the collection workflow database is updated regularly and maintained with current activity summary. Ensure all appeals for adjustments, write-offs and bad debts are maintained and current.

    Required Experience Proficient in Microsoft Office, especially Excel Must have initiative, attention-to-detail, can-do attitude Excellent communication and interpersonal skills Problem-solving and critical-thinking skills Must be a quick learner, comfortable learning computer/accounting software, and comfortable managing Excel spreadsheets Be able to handle high volume workflow in fast paced environment Preferred Experience Associate's/Bachelor's degree.

    Working knowledge of a collection control functions and legal billing procedures and cycles. Working knowledge of Elite 3e or similar financial systems. Working knowledge of the e-billing systems for law firms.
